If I remember correctly — and I may not! — it's not a "special" playlist but just something that's automatically created by iTunes/Music/Apple Music and then added to as you buy new songs. So, any time it's recreated, it's only from that point in time forward.

You might be able to use smart playlist with criteria like "is purchased" to recreate something like it in iTunes and sync it across?
